Collaboration options

Biomass Booster (BMB) has a wide portfolio of collaboration options, designed to cover any need of our clients or partners.

Agreements can typically be derived from:

Co-development services

BMB is interested in the co-development and co-commercialization of genetically modified plants and algae strains optimized for the production of biofuels, therefore it is looking for strategic partners interested in sharing both the risks and the industrial property generated. BMB's client-partners will license BMB's base technology and can obtain a lower financial risk in their projects.

Out-licensing of products

In its eagerness to innovate, BMB can develop a portfolio of its own products in different development paths that can be licensed by our clients.

R&D services

BMB offers R&D services to third parties specialized in the selection, characterization and genetic optimization of algae and higher plants, with flexible approaches to the sharing of the industrial property generated.

BMB offers its services in two modalities:

FTE

This flexible format makes it possible to hire BMB staff on a full-time equivalent, making it possible to have extra staff to deal with peak work in its R&D department or to hire scientific staff only when deemed necessary.

Research under contract

Our team of experts will analyze your needs and design a research project tailored to your needs, with the advantage that you will have a closed budget from the start of it.

Our clients

There are four large groups of clients interested in BMB technology:

GERMPLASM COMPANIES

Companies dedicated to the production of high-yield germplasm for use as energy crops and other applications.

PLANT PRODUCTION COMPANIES

Companies will be able to benefit from lower raw material production costs, whether they are vertically integrated or by recommending the use of BMB technology to their biomass suppliers.

RESEARCHERS SPECIALIZED IN PLANT GENETIC MODIFICATION

Researchers and specialists in biotechnology and genetic modification of plant species that are interested in the project.

PRODUCERS OF PLANT SPECIES

Producers will be able to benefit from a lower cost and be able to increase their production and improve the performance of their sales.
